We had cheese, pinapple,mini-toms, silverskin onions,hot-dog sausage and gherkins all on sticks with diff combinations....or you could give out empty sticks and let people stab their own (if you know what I mean)


I remember eating half boiled eggs (yolk scooped out, mixed with mayo and put back) made into sail boats with a triangle half of plastic cheese  on a cocktail stick as a sail.....we thought it was posh back then.

and of course sarnies without crusts ...how extravagant!
